WILDFLOWERS! I love these daisies this year. My ballerina helped me plant the seeds about 2 years ago. We didn't expect them to do well in our soil. Our town has clay-based soil. I wasn't sure how the wildflowers would do. Well....they are beautiful. I have 2 groupings of them along this neighbor's fence. I like clipping some for a small bud vase I have and placing it on the counter near the coffeepot...it brightens my morning!
